Los Angeles, California - Rihanna is Elle's September 2026 cover star, posing in a chic Dior look to celebrate her status as the brand's latest fragrance muse.
Photographed by Inez and Vinoodh and styled by Jahleel Weaver, Rihanna appears on the new cover wearing an oversized Dior headpiece and matching ring.
Her hair is down and wavy with soft, natural glam makeup as she leans against a wooden crate.
The shoot ties into Rihanna's new role as the face of Dior's J'Adore Intense fragrance, which the brand says was designed as a tribute to her, built around the idea of a free-spirited woman who embraces life with confidence.
It's another milestone in her decade-plus relationship with the fashion house.
The 38-year-old became Dior's first Black ambassador back in 2015.
In the accompanying cover story, writer Roxane Gay reflects on how Rihanna carries herself with total self-assurance, living life on her own terms rather than bending to outside expectations.
Additional shots from the spread show the beauty mogul in a range of looks, including a pale blue outfit with a feathered collar, a black gown paired with mesh socks, and a fuzzy red wrap.
She shared several photos from the shoot on her own social accounts on Tuesday.
